titleOfInvention Novel antimicrobial polymer-graphene-silver nanocomposite
abstract A nanocomposite comprising a copolymer of styrene and methyl methacrylate and reduced graphene oxide/silver nanoparticles (PS-PMMA/RGO/AgNPs) was prepared via in situ bulk polymerization method. Two different preparation techniques were used. In a first approach, a mixture of graphene oxide (GO), styrene (S) and methyl methacrylate (MMA) monomers were polymerized using a bulk polymerization method with a free radical initiator. After the addition of silver nitrate (AgNO 3 ), the product was reduced via microwave irradiation (MWI) in the presence of hydrazine hydrate (HH), to obtain R-(GO-(PS-PMMA))/AgNPs nanocomposite. Materials with antimicrobial properties, comprising the nanocomposite, were further obtained and used for medical devices or medical related implants. In a second approach, a nanocomposite was prepared without MWI.
